So now it’s the turn of the very charming Alex who’s been harbouring deep feelings for Xavier’s Grand-daughter Ashleigh for more than a decade. He’s managed to stay away from her considering the ten year age gap too big but now she’s moving back to Dallas and will be walking around in front of him, tempting him like never before.

Ashleigh is a complete paradox � she’s a very successful erotic author with virtually no sexual experience of her own. She’s been pumping Sam & Sierra for explicit details of their sex-lives to give her a better insight but there’s no experience like hands-on experience and she and Alex are not going to be able to resist that burning, magnetic attraction that simmers between them for long.

I’ve really adored Alex since we first met him in Book One. He’s got a bit of a swagger going on, is very charming, grins a lot, yes, I’ve been crushing on Alex! He’s absolutely typical Nicole Edwards alpha hero, he’s also a very noble soul doing right by his ex-wife who’s lost in addiction and, of course, he’s drop dead gorgeous.

Ashleigh tries for a while to keep her distance but it was never going to be easy. They date slowly for a while and this really is all about the Seduction until, one day, they explosively come together � that mutual attraction to be denied no longer. Alex frustrates Ashleigh by treating her with kid-gloves when she really just wants him to unleash his wilder side with her.

So, we set out on another deliciously erotic path in this one. There’s no menage in this one but it’s no less hotter than that � Alex and Ashleigh almost set fire to my Kindle and we have a sinful little get together with Sam & Logan and Sierra, Cole & Ashley which is NOT to be missed. That’s the beauty of this kind of series � you have a complete story in each book but you get to catch up with the central characters from the previous books. No cliffhangers, just erotic awesomeness!

Having read Kaleb, which was released after this one, it was wonderful to see the Walker Brothers getting a little bit of an introduction towards the end of this one � I’m really looking forward to these two series developing alongside one another and I almost beside myself with anticipation at what may go on at Club Desitny and Alluring Indulgence in future books. Bring it on!!

Ashleigh’s broken-hearted grief-stricken brother Dylan really made my heart hurt. I do hope Nicole Edwards can find a little bit of happy for him in the future sometime very soon. Maybe with Sara?

4 stars
